Output e7880b60f695d77665c5c2ae65d4615a3af9c41303d29cab55d43623d4aae95f:1

value
4330369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fd581e07d741923ac27b44ff1d14251eae3955e OP_EQUALVERIFY OP_CHECKSIG
address
15MvXmQAXYHvb7NDxspsvKfoX2iw1rqjuc
transaction
e7880b60f695d77665c5c2ae65d4615a3af9c41303d29cab55d43623d4aae95f
spent
true